把数字货币安全注入TP钱包:从入金到合约监控的实务指南

把数字货币放进TP钱包并不是单一步骤,而是一组相互关联的流程:用户入金、通道优化、合约监控与平台对接。先说用户视角:新用户注册应聚焦无摩擦与安全并重。引导用户生成或导入助记词、强制备份、设置本地加密密码并建议开启生物识别。当用户要接收资产,展示明确的asset/chahttps://www.suhedaojia.com ,in标签,避免copy-paste错误,支持二维码与地址识别,并在首次转账前提示链上费用与预计确认时间。

技术层面,状态通道可以把小额、高频支付从链上移到链下,加速体验并节省gas。实现路径是:链上部署管理合约→双方提交初始保证金→离线交换状态签名→结算时上链提交最新状态并关闭通道。对开发者来说,需实现断线重连、状态编号、防双重花费逻辑与挑战/争议解决机制。

在代码安全方面,防格式化字符串不是口号。任何把地址、数额或用户输入拼接进日志或命令的环节,都要用参数化接口或安全格式化函数,避免把可控输入当作格式串,防止信息泄露与异常行为。对RPC返回和合约事件做严格类型检查,避免未校验的数据进入签名或展示层。

面向新兴市场支付平台,TP钱包可以作为收单与结算端:集成本地法币通道、支持轻钱包支付SDK、提供离链清算与分账API。针对不稳定网络,优先采用可恢复的消息队列、事务幂等设计与延迟容错策略,降低服务中断风险。

合约监控是运维的眼睛。建议部署链上监听器,实时解析Transfer/Approval等事件,计入索引库并对异常模式(大量未确认tx、短时间内高频退单)触发告警。结合重放保护、重组回滚逻辑与人工复核流程,形成闭环响应。

最后给出专家解读:在用户体验与链上安全间需持续权衡,状态通道与离链清算能显著改善支付体验,但必须配套健壮的争议解决与监控体系。对开发者的建议是,把安全与可观测性当作第一公设,简化新用户路径的同时,不放松对输入校验、日志处理和合约事件审计的要求。只有这样,才能把数字资产既方便又稳妥地放进TP钱包并运行在新兴市场的真实场景中。

作者:李宸发布时间:2025-12-31 18:08:21

评论

Alex88

很实用的指南,关于状态通道的争议解决部分能否给出开源实现推荐?

小北

对防格式化字符串的强调很有必要,之前就在日志拼接上遇到过坑。

Ming_Z

合约监控那段说到位,尤其是回滚与重放保护,运维必读。

雨辰

结合新兴市场的离线支付场景,能否补充本地法币对接的合规要点?

CryptoNinja

喜欢最后的总结,把用户体验和安全并重说得很清楚。

林楠

建议增加一个新手快速入门流程图,帮助非技术用户理解。

相关阅读